'FRISCO MAIL.
(To the Editor of the Times).;
Sir, —I see by the papers that tho San Fraucisco mail service is ratified. Now, why should not tho Union Steam Ship Company help us people south of Auckland ? By yesterday’s paper wo see that the Union Steam Ship Company’s boat is a day late leaving ' Auckland, Now why could they not have a boat leaving on receipt of tho San Francisco mail, which arrives in Auckland almost invariably on Mondays. It is only once in three weeks, so surely they could give us south of Auckland the benefit of the quick service by putting on an extra boat. Hoping that you will see your way dear to publish this.—l am, &c., E.T.H.
